How long should exterior paint last in Danversport's coastal climate?

Quality exterior paint should last 7-10 years in Danversport when applied correctly with proper materials. Coastal conditions are tougher than inland areas, so standard paint jobs often fail in 3-5 years. The key difference is using marine-grade primers and topcoats designed for salt air exposure. These materials cost more upfront but save money long-term by lasting longer between repaints. Proper surface preparation also matters more here because salt buildup and moisture can cause premature failure if not addressed. We see many properties that need repainting every few years because the wrong materials were used initially. Investing in quality materials and proper application techniques extends the life of your paint job significantly.
Late spring through early fall offers the best conditions for exterior painting in Massachusetts. May through September typically provides consistent temperatures and lower humidity levels that help paint cure properly. Interior painting can happen year-round since climate control maintains stable conditions. However, ventilation is important during application and drying, so mild weather makes the process more comfortable for everyone involved. We avoid painting during periods of high humidity, extreme temperatures, or when rain is expected within 24 hours of application. Rushing to beat weather often leads to poor results, so we schedule projects when conditions support quality work rather than just getting paint on surfaces quickly.
Coastal preparation requires removing salt buildup, addressing moisture damage, and ensuring surfaces are completely clean and dry before priming. We power wash with fresh water to remove salt deposits that can interfere with paint adhesion. Scraping and sanding remove loose or failing paint, while caulking seals gaps where moisture can penetrate. Any wood damage gets repaired before priming because coastal moisture can cause rapid deterioration if left unaddressed. Multiple primer coats are often necessary on previously unpainted or heavily weathered surfaces. We use high-quality primers designed for coastal conditions that block moisture and provide superior adhesion for topcoats. This extra preparation time is essential for long-lasting results in Danversport’s environment.
Acrylic latex paints with high-quality resins perform best in New England’s variable climate. These paints expand and contract with temperature changes without cracking, while resisting fading from UV exposure and moisture penetration. For coastal areas like Danversport, we recommend paints with enhanced mildew resistance and salt air protection. Premium brands offer formulations specifically designed for harsh coastal environments that outperform standard exterior paints. Interior paints should be low-VOC or zero-VOC for better indoor air quality, especially during New England’s long winter months when homes stay closed up. Quality interior paints also resist humidity changes better, preventing issues like peeling in bathrooms and kitchens.
Exterior painting typically costs $3-6 per square foot depending on surface condition, prep work required, and paint quality selected. Coastal properties often need more preparation work, which affects total project cost but ensures longer-lasting results. Interior painting generally runs $2-4 per square foot for walls and ceilings. Trim work, specialty finishes, and high ceilings increase costs due to additional time and skill required. Commercial projects vary widely based on size, complexity, and timeline requirements. We provide detailed written estimates breaking down materials, labor, and preparation work so you understand exactly what you’re paying for. Quality materials and proper preparation cost more initially but save money long-term through extended paint life and fewer maintenance issues.
